A global manufacturing leader based in Indonesia is seeking an experienced sales professional for the pre-engineered building (PEB) sector. This position requires at least 5 years of sales experience in the industry, along with a degree in Civil Engineering or a relevant field. The successful candidate will manage customer relationships, generate project inquiries, negotiate contracts, and coordinate project execution. Proficiency in tools like AutoCAD and MS-Excel is essential for effective performance in this role.
Kirby International established in 1976 is a global leader in the designing and manufacturing of pre-engineered steel buildings and structures. Offering customers a wide range of customized, cost effective steel building solutions. Kirby’s global spread extends across Middle East, Africa, Asia, Indian subcontinent and South East Asia with production capacity exceeding 400,000 MT annually, operating across 70 countries with workforce of 4,000 people. Kirby International is subsidiary of Alghanim Industries – one of the largest conglomerate in Middle East.
About Kirby South East Asia
Kirby South East Asia started its operation in 2008 with its 50,000 MT annual capacity plant in Vietnam. In its few years of operation Kirby SEA has designed and supplied various buildings in Vietnam, Singapore, Thailand, Malaysia, Philippines, Indonesia, Cambodia, Laos, Australia, Bangladesh and Myanmar markets. Kirby South East Asia is a wholly owned subsidiary of Kirby International.
